  • Title

    Area/bandwidth tradeoffs for CMOS current mirrors

  • Abstract
    Conventional CMOS current mirrors with large current ratios require very large active areas and have limited bandwidths. It is shown that replacing the inefficient large ratio current mirrors with a cascade of smaller current mirrors can give significant increases in bandwidth and reductions in active area. A simple design strategy is presented which can be used to obtain near optimal tradeoffs between active area and bandwidth.
